Analysis

The most recent figure for number of indigenous p. vivax malaria cases in Saudi Arabia is 0, measured in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 7 years on record.

The figure is down 100.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, number of indigenous p. vivax malaria cases in Saudi Arabia peaked at 5 in 2017 and was at its lowest, 0, in 2021.

Saudi Arabia ranks 39th of 59 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

Number of indigenous P. vivax malaria cases in Saudi Arabia, year by year

Annual values for Number of indigenous P. vivax malaria cases in Saudi Arabia, 2016 to 2024.
Year Value Change
2016 2
2017 5 +150.0%
2018 4 -20.0%
2021 0 -100.0%
2022 0
2023 0
2024 0
